Abstract

A method for purifying a fluorinated carboxylic acid having an etheric oxygen atom and its derivative, with small decomposition and inclusion of impurities. A liquid containing at least one member selected from the group consisting of a fluorinated compound represented by application formulae (1) and (2) is held at a heating temperature of at most 150° C. and distilled. Further, the liquid is a liquid obtained from any of a waste liquid after an aqueous emulsion of a fluoropolymer is coagulated and the fluoropolymer is separated, an aqueous liquid obtained by cleaning an exhaust gas in a step of drying and/or a step of heat treatment of the separated fluoropolymer, and a liquid obtained by cleaning an anion exchange resin which has been brought into contact with the waste liquid or an aqueous dispersion obtained from the aqueous emulsion of the fluoropolymer, with an alkaline aqueous solution.

Claims (31)

1. A method for recovering a fluorinated compound, which compound is at least one selected from the group consisting of a fluorinated compound represented by formula (1) and a fluorinated compound represented by formula (2):

R F OR 1 COOH  (1)

R F OR 1 COOR 2   (2)

wherein R F is a linear or branched monovalent fluoroorganic group which may have an etheric oxygen atom in its main chain, R I is a linear or branched bivalent organic group, and R 2 is a linear or branched monovalent organic group,

wherein said method comprises distilling:

a waste liquid remaining after an aqueous emulsion of a fluoropolymer is coagulated and the fluoropolymer is separated, or

an aqueous liquid obtained by cleaning an exhaust gas originating from drying and/or heat treating a fluoropolymer, or

a liquid obtained by cleaning an anion exchange resin with an alkaline aqueous solution,

at a heating temperature of at most 150° C., wherein said waste liquid, said aqueous liquid and said liquid obtained by cleaning an anion exchange resin comprise at least one fluorinated compound represented by formula (1) or formula (2).
